Check engine light came on in the Girlfriends 2007 Outlook. Code P0496, " Evaporative emission system high purge flow" As best as I could search this forum and Google, I am going to replace the Purge solenoid. Problem is I do not know where to look on the car for this part.. Somehow NAPA had 1 in stock, so I plan to fix it this weekend.
Her symptoms incase anyone else needs to know beside the check engine light and code are, no start after putting any gas in it, and during the second attempt at starting, long crank time with the motor kind of sounding like it has a big cam in it for a second.

I believe the purge solenoid is mounted on the upper intake manifold.
Correct... if you are looking at the Throttle Body from the front of the vehicle, the Purge Solenoid sits just forward of the Throttle Body. It is held on by one bolt, and has one electrical connector and a vacuum line w/quick disconnect fitting attached to it.
